The test is divided into three sections and intends to evaluate your pronunciation, fluency, grammar, and vocabulary.&nbsp;<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"has-larger-font-size wp-block-heading\" id=\"h-what-types-of-questions-are-asked-in-the-ielts-speaking-test\"><span id=\"what-types-of-questions-are-asked-in-the-ielts-speaking-test\"><strong>What Types Of Questions Are Asked In The IELTS Speaking Test?<\/strong><\/span><\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p>Depending on the examiner, you may be given various questions and be required to talk on multiple themes. The way you respond, however, is determined by the exam portion.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\" id=\"h-ielts-speaking-test-part-one\"><span id=\"ielts-speaking-test-part-one\"><strong>IELTS speaking test part one<\/strong><\/span><\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p>You&#8217;ll probably be asked several questions about yourself in part one of the IELTS speaking test, such as your interests, family, studies, and home. Consider it an initial talk and an opportunity to introduce yourself to the examiner. <\/p>\n\n\n\n<p><strong>IELTS SPEAKING TEST SAMPLE QUESTIONS<\/strong><\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>The following are some of the other frequently asked questions in section one:<\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\"><li>Work&nbsp;<\/li><li>Hobbies&nbsp;<\/li><li>Sport&nbsp;<\/li><li>Television and films&nbsp;<\/li><li>Weather&nbsp;<\/li><li>Daily routine&nbsp;<\/li><li>Technology<\/li><li>Shopping&nbsp;<\/li><li>Socializing&nbsp;<\/li><li>Food<\/li><\/ul>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\" id=\"h-ielts-speaking-test-part-two\"><span id=\"ielts-speaking-test-part-two\"><strong>IELTS speaking test part two<\/strong><\/span><\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p>You are given a card with a topic and some information about the main areas you should try to discuss in part two of the IELTS speaking test. Before speaking, you will have approximately a minute to jot down some notes. You&#8217;ll get one to two minutes to talk on the topic, after which the examiner will give you some follow-up questions.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p><strong>IELTS SPEAKING TEST SAMPLE QUESTIONS<\/strong><\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Part two&#8217;s subjects are centered on your life experiences and can include things like:<\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\"><li>Art&nbsp;<\/li><li>Books&nbsp;<\/li><li>Advice&nbsp;<\/li><li>Communication&nbsp;<\/li><li>Hobbies&nbsp;<\/li><li>Routines&nbsp;<\/li><li>Sport<\/li><li>Family&nbsp;<\/li><li>News&nbsp;<\/li><li>Music and film&nbsp;<\/li><li>Travel&nbsp;<\/li><li>Values<\/li><\/ul>\n\n\n\n<p>For example, you might be asked about a sport you want to try. You&#8217;d have to explain the sport, how you&#8217;d prepare for it, what equipment you&#8217;d need to play it, and why the sport appeals to you. For part two of the IELTS speaking examination, the smart idea is to talk as long as you can or until the examiner tells you to stop.&nbsp;<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p><strong>READ ALSO: <a href=\"https:\/\/mystudentkit.com\/blog\/business-ideas-for-college-students\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">13 Business Ideas For College Students With Little Or No Capital<\/a><\/strong><\/p>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\" id=\"h-ielts-speaking-test-part-three\"><span id=\"ielts-speaking-test-part-three\"><strong>IELTS speaking test part three<\/strong><\/span><\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p>Part three of the test requires you to speak about the same subject as part two. The difference is that you have the opportunity to debate the issue with the examiner and go deeper into it. You&#8217;ll be asked for your thoughts and opinions on the subject.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p><strong>IELTS SPEAKING TEST SAMPLE<\/strong><\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>If art was chosen as the second topic of discussion, you might be asked questions like:<\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\"><li>What do you think art&#8217;s worth?<\/li><li>What kind of art do you enjoy and why?<\/li><li>What distinguishes a good work of art?<\/li><li>What are your thoughts on the advantages of knowing about art?<\/li><li>What are your country&#8217;s creative traditions and styles?<\/li><\/ul>\n\n\n\n<p>Don&#8217;t be scared to voice your opinion or demonstrate your knowledge on a subject. Understand the Speaking Test Format<\/strong><\/span><\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p>This may sound like a no-brainer, yet many students enter the IELTS speaking test with little prior knowledge of what to expect.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>The speaking test is broken down into three sections and takes between 11 and 14 minutes to complete. Part 1 will last about 4-5 minutes and will consist of questions about yourself and your family. The examiner may also inquire about your hometown, place of employment or study, family, or interests. This section will assist you in relaxing and naturally conversing about common themes.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>You will be handed a card with a topic on it in part 2. A list of topics to discuss will also be included on the card. One minute is allotted for you to read the card, take notes, and plan your response. Then you&#8217;ll have to speak for 1-2 minutes regarding the subject. When you are speaking, the examiner will not ask you any questions or assist you in any way.&nbsp;<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Part 3 of the speaking test is the most abstract, and students typically find it the most difficult. The examiner will ask you questions about the topic you discussed in part 2, and this section will last about 4-5 minutes. The examiner may ask you to talk about the past, present, or future, express your opinion, discuss hypothetical circumstances, compare and contrast, or evaluate the views of others.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p><strong><a href=\"https:\/\/mystudentkit.com\/ielts\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">GET YOUR IELTS STUDY MATERIAL AND START PREPARING<\/a><\/strong><\/p>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\" id=\"h-2-know-what-the-examiner-wants\"><span id=\"2-know-what-the-examiner-wants\"><strong>2. Know What the Examiner Wants<\/strong><\/span><\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p>It is critical that you comprehend how the exam will be graded.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>There are four criteria for grading:<\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\"><li><strong>Fluency and coherence<\/strong> &#8211; Fluency refers to your ability to speak freely and without awkward pauses. The examiner&#8217;s ability to understand what you mean is measured by coherence.<\/li><li><strong>Lexical resource<\/strong> &#8211; The ability to employ a wide range of language responsibly and accurately is referred to as a lexical resource.<\/li><li><strong>Grammatical range and accuracy<\/strong> &#8211; You should employ a variety of proper grammatical structures and make your sentences as error-free as feasible.<\/li><li><strong>Pronunciation <\/strong>&#8211; Your speech should be clear and include all aspects of pronunciation, including intonation, sentence stress, and weak sounds.<\/li><\/ul>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\" id=\"h-3-know-your-current-band\"><span id=\"3-know-your-current-band\"><strong>3. Set Your Target and Make a Timeline<\/strong><\/span><\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p>You should establish a goal and make a timeframe now that you know your current IELTS speaking band. At this point, it&#8217;s critical to remain grounded.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>&nbsp;To go up half an IELTS band typically requires 200-300 hours of study time. As a result, improving your score by half a band would take between 3-5 months if you studied 20 hours a week.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>It&#8217;s important to remember that everyone is unique, and the figures above are only a guideline. Some people progress faster than others. Also, the 200-300 hour rule applies to someone who is attempting to improve all four skills; if you are only attempting to improve your speaking, you may be able to get away with less time.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>SEE <a href=\"https:\/\/mystudentkit.com\/blog\/how-to-prepare-for-ielts-at-home\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">How To Prepare For IELTS Exam At Home | Expert Advice<\/a><\/p>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\" id=\"h-5-make-a-study-plan\"><span id=\"5-make-a-study-plan\"><strong>5. Learn From Your Mistakes<\/strong><\/span><\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p>You should figure out what your common flaws or faults are and then work on improving them. Some people are highly fluent speakers but have a lot of grammar problems, others are very proficient at grammar but speak at a languid pace, and yet others are difficult to understand because they need pronunciation help.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>You can find a reputable IELTS teacher in your area or online and ask them to bring out your areas of weakness or if you have a buddy who is fluent in English and is a native or advanced speaker, they can also assist you. Finally, you can record yourself to assist you to identify and correct your flaws.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\" id=\"h-8-prepare-for-the-ielts-speaking-test-by-listening-and-reading\"><span id=\"8-prepare-for-the-ielts-speaking-test-by-listening-and-reading\"><strong>8. Extend Your Answers<\/strong><\/span><\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p>Giving very short replies is one of the ways pupils can obtain a low grade. Practice not only stating your answer but also explaining it and providing instances from your own life. This will assist you in developing a habit, which will result in greater exam scores.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>If you were asked, &#8220;Who is the friendliest person you know?&#8221; for example, what would you say? There are two possible responses:<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Answer 1\u2013 &#8216;My mother is the kindest person I know.&#8217;<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Answer 2\u2013 &#8216;My mother is the kindest person I know since she gave us everything she had growing up and made many sacrifices.&#8217; For example, instead of buying herself anything, Mom would always buy us clothes and books.&#8217;<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Although Answer 1 is correct, it is so brief that the examiner cannot assess your skills.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>You&#8217;ve demonstrated to the examiner that you can thoroughly answer the question and employ a variety of grammar and vocabulary by using the A-E-E formula (Answer-Explain-Example). It will be more difficult for you to achieve a high score if you do not do this.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\" id=\"h-how-is-the-ielts-speaking-test-marked\"><span id=\"how-is-the-ielts-speaking-test-marked\"><strong>How Is The IELTS Speaking Test Marked?<\/strong><\/span><\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p>Examiners for the IELTS speaking test expect you to demonstrate a variety of skills and abilities.
